Chocolate Chip Cookies

Ingredients

  • 2 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up vegetable shortening
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 3/4 cup packed light br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. Sift flour, baking soda and salt in medium bowl.
  3. Using an electric mixer or stand mixer, beat butter and and shortening in large bowl until fluffy. Add sugar, brown sugar, and vanilla and beat well. Beat in eggs one at a time. Gradually add in flour mixture. Stir in chocolate chips by hand.
  4. Drop tablespoon size mounds on to nonstick cookie sheets spacing each about 2 inches apart.
  5. Bake cookies about 9-12 minutes until golden brown. Let cool for 5 minutes then transfer to wire racks.
